MANUFACTURING METHOD OF INORGANIC HARDENED BODY, AND INORGANIC HARDENED BODY

机译:无机硬化体的制造方法以及无机硬化体

摘要

PROBLEM TO BE SOLVED: To provide a manufacturing method of an inorganic hardened body which has both lightweight and pliable properties, while maintaining excellent moisture absorbing-releasing properties, and a hardened body strength and which is excellent in workability in construction, such as nailing characteristics and cutting properties, on the occasion of application to a wall or the ceiling and hardly causes nonuniformity in the quality of construction, and to provide the inorganic hardened body.;SOLUTION: In the manufacturing method of the inorganic hardened body, the mixture of an inorganic powder containing a calcium silicate compound (preferably containing wallastonite), pulp of 2-20 pts.wt. (and moisture absorbing-releasing material of 10-70 pts.wt.) to 100 pts.wt. of the inorganic powder and water is dehydrated by sheet forming, shaped so that the water content is 10-50 wt.%, and then subjected to carbonation processing. Calcium carbonate, amorphous silica (and the moisture absorbing-releasing material) and the pulp are contained in the hardened body subjected to the carbonation processing, and the content of the amorphous silica is 3 wt.% or above.;COPYRIGHT: (C)2005,JPO&NCIPI
